WordPress designs are saved separately from the content as theme files. Any basic WordPress installation will come with at least one design installed, and there are thousands more to choose from.

Themes control the colors, layout, and fonts of your site. They may also include some images – backgrounds, icons, etc.

Like WordPress itself, the themes are often provided freely (though some are offered as paid add-ons with customization and support). For our theme, we chose a free theme to start with the core code, then added a “child theme” to customize the design and other options.
